Hey guys, im new to the ht forums and also hondas in general, i've mostly been a dsm guy, but ive always liked hondas
I just picked up a 94 gsr a few weeks ago, i'm tight on cash so i'd like to know where my money would be best spent at on the motor
Current mods to the car
Koni shocks
Nuespeed sport springs
Aem Pulleys
Aem Fuel Rail
DC Sports 4-1 header
Aem intake
AFPR
Front and Rear strut bars
Lower rear sway
2.5" Catback 5Zigen exhaust

Your research will/should involve looking at many options. Most options/modfications beyond what you have now will most likley require tuning so getting Hondata S100 or even chipped ecu via Crome to allow for tuning of fuel and ignition maps will be the foundation for futher performance modifications.
rocket is right as usual.
i would get some adjustable cam gears,even stock cams can see good gains.
install hondata s100 your already obd-1 so thats good just use your stock ecu then hit the dyno with a good tuner
